Why can't fmp just be started without having to setup a start shortcut or through CMD line? Drives me crazy.
All programs (UT, DSD+, ...) are started from a shortcut or from the command line. You can start all required programs (UT + DSD+, FMP + DSD+, FMPx2 + DSD+x2, etc.) from a single shortcut if you want to.


And then all these little parameters about telling FMP where DSD+ is located. AAAArgh.
The provided FMP.cfg file already points to the current folder ("."), which is where DSD+ should be anyway, so no need to change anything.


BTW, if I am using Unitrunker stand alone with 2 dongles (1 dongle with Airspy) and I have DSD+ running as decoder, won't I get similar results with trunking? I suppose the advantage of only using FMP is that you can hop around to non-trunking frequencies and listen to them as well.
UT/DSD+ and FMP/DSD+ handle different trunking system types. UT/DSD+ is for Moto Type II (P25 CAI), P25 phase 1 and EDACS (ProVoice audio). FMP/DSD+ is for NXDN and DMR trunking.
